# Daniel Lev

> Daniel Lev is the Chicago-based co-founder and CEO of Coinflow, a payment service provider that connects familiar payment methods with stablecoin settlement. A software engineering graduate who worked on financial infrastructure at PwC and Amount, Lev arrived at the idea through a failed conversion problem at his earlier fantasy-sports startup. Coinflow spun out of that need in late 2022 and raised a $25 million Series A led by Pantera Capital in October 2025.

## Career timeline

- **2017-2021** — Served as Head of Product for The Boo Radley Foundation, including work on its CowChips4Charity fundraising platform.
- **2019** — Completed an Iowa State software engineering capstone whose CowChips4Charity team received the department's best software project award.
- **Before 2022** — Worked on financial infrastructure at PwC and Amount, including products for banks and financial institutions.
- **2021-2022** — Built Phantasia Sports, a fantasy-sports product on Solana; payment conversion problems led the team to create internal payment infrastructure.
- **Late 2022** — Co-founded Coinflow after spinning the payment infrastructure out of Phantasia Sports.
- **2023** — Coinflow began serving customers and Lev appeared on Set in Stone to discuss digital-asset off-ramps and traditional finance.
- **2024** — Coinflow raised a $2.25 million seed round and Lev discussed global payment networks on the Lightspeed podcast.
- **2025** — Coinflow raised a $25 million Series A led by Pantera Capital, with participation from Coinbase Ventures, Reciprocal Ventures and Jump Crypto.
- **2026** — Continued publishing on cross-border and stablecoin payment infrastructure and announced Coinflow's partnership with Tempo for machine payments.
